  • craftinamerica.org. Watch Cristina Córdova sculpt a head out of clay. Bonus video from the IDENTITY episode.
    "Identity: 4 Voices" is an exhibition inspired by the IDENTITY episode on view at the Craft in America Center March 14-May 2, 2020. During the closure of the Craft in America Center, we invite you to explore this exhibition virtually at www.craftinamerica.org/exhibition/identity-4-voices-virtual-exhibition
    The Craft in America Center in Los Angeles is a craft-focused library and gallery offering artist talks, workshops, exhibits and educational programs.
